Ishan Sahoo
Oracle, Santa Clara, California, USA
Brief Bio Data :
Isan Sahoo is a Principal Software Engineer specializing in large-scale AI cloud infrastructure and AI-driven control planes. He has over a decade of experience designing and operating mission-critical infrastructure platforms that support AI training, inference, and data-intensive workloads at a global scale, with a focus on scalability, reliability, and infrastructure optimization.
He is actively engaged in the global research and professional community, serving as Program Chair of the Association for Computing Machinery (ACM) Fremont Professional Chapter and contributing extensively as a peer reviewer, having completed more than 270 reviews for international conferences and journals in artificial intelligence, cloud computing, and advanced infrastructure systems.
Isan is a frequent author and speaker at IEEE and other international forums, where he publishes and presents research on AI infrastructure, cloud control planes, and AI-enabled infrastructure automation. He is a Fellow of the British Computer Society (BCS), a Distinguished Fellow of the Soft Computing Research Society (SCRS), and a Senior Member of the Institute of Electrical and Electronics Engineers (IEEE). Through conference leadership, scholarly contributions, and industry–academia collaboration, he continues to advance AI infrastructure engineering worldwide
